How Far From Pace to ...

We spend a lot of time looking through Gazetteers & Almanacs that were published in the late 1800's and early 1900's. Many of the Gazetteers include the distance from a community such as Pace to various places of note, such as the White House.

With a nod to our favorite Gazetteers and using the location of where the historic community of Pace once stood, the straight-line distance beginning in Pace and extending to:

  • Paris, which is the Seat of Henry County, lies 16 miles [25.7 km]<1> to the west southwest. If you could walk a straight line from Pace to Paris, with an average speed<5> of 2.2 miles [3.5 km] per hour, it would take most of a day to make the trip. A horse and buggy averaging 3.2 miles [5.1 km] per hour would take five to six hours.
  • Nashville, which is the State Capital of Tennessee, lies 72 miles [115.9 km] to the east southeast (ESE). Driving, with an average speed of 63 miles [101.4 km] per hour, would take less than two hours, a buggy would take most of three days and walking would take 4 days.
  • The White House (Washington, DC) is 626 miles [1,007.4 km] to the east northeast (ENE). Driving would take just over a day, a buggy would take 25 days and walking would take 36 days.

<6>The shortest line can be visualized by stretching a string on a Globe from Point A to Point B - this is known as a Great Circle Route. Where you might expect the shortest route from Pace to the Middle East to be East and South, the Great Circle Route actually lies to the North and East.
